Come up with a plan B. All of that is impressive for your age but there are 17 year olds styling out triple corks. Almost any large company in the snowboard industry isn't looking for "sometimes landing 360s" when they give out sponsorships, so just keep practicing and see where you are at in a few years. You may be able to get local sponsors to help with costs of gear, passes, etc. however, so just make a sponsor-me video and drop off the disk with places you think may be interested in sponsoring a young rider. Most of all just ride because you like it, there is nothing wrong with making films just because either, plus video editing/filming can be of use to you down the road. Oh and also try competing at your local resorts in any youth competitions, placing in them will get you noticed for sure especially if you do so regularly. Some smaller competitions also offer the opportunity to compete at bigger and much more popular comp's elsewhere (in addition to the prizes).

Becoming a professional in any sport takes a lot of work and dedication. Everyone else pretty much covered the basics. There are only two other things I can recommend. First, attend as many advanced camps and classes as you can. This will give you a chance to learn new moves and will let you begin networking with other riders and pros who may help you out later. Second, send your video to various contests held by major companies to make yourself a little more visible. For example, Rome SDS has annual "Local GNAR" competition (youtube "rome local gnar"). That might be a good start. Good luck.

Most riders start with local sponsors and work their way up to national sponsors. Start by having someone follow you with a GoPro and make a video of you riding. Don't edit it too much - sponsors like to see the whole run. Show it to local businesses and ask for sponsorship from them. I would also recommend entering competitions. One of the riders I know was sponsored by a local yogurt shop. Get creative and work at getting sponsors just as hard as you work at riding. Don't listen to these other guys cutting you down. I know riders that can't do half what you do and they have sponsors.
